West Linn starts off strong, defeats Jesuit 84-43 in OSAA State Quarterfinals

In the 6A OSAA State Basketball Quarterfinals West Linn (24-3, 14-0 Three Rivers League) cruised to a victory against 8th seeded Jesuit (18-9, 9-5 Metro League) 84-43.

The Lions came out strong early, as point guard Payton Pritchard, senior, hit four straight three pointers, contributing to  West Linn’s  28-13 lead at the end of the first quarter.

The second quarter was no different, as the Lions kept building momentum to hold a 37-18 lead at halftime.

Jesuit was unable to keep up with the Lions in the second half. West Linn finished off the Crusaders with a 84-43 win.

The Lions now advance to their fifth straight OSAA 6A Semifinal, where they will take on 13th seeded Jefferson (19-8, 12-4 Portland Interscholastic League), Friday 6:30 p.m. at the University of Portland’s Chiles Center. Tickets cost $5 for students and $10 for adults.
